There are alot of valid points being made about this subject.&amp;nbsp; But I myself was always worried if I could get my kids off my bus fast enough if something happened.</description></item><item><title>Re: Do you think the seatbealt laws should be on our childrens school buses also?</title><link>http://community.fox16.com/forums/thread/3546678.aspx</link><pubDate>Sun, 26 Oct 2008 03:32:59 GMT</pubDate><guid isPermaLink="false">f186169e-3fc6-4c95-bcbb-b5b7b525c38e:3546678</guid><dc:creator>donaxemena</dc:creator><slash:comments>0</slash:comments><comments>http://community.fox16.com/forums/thread/3546678.aspx</comments><wfw:commentRss>http://community.fox16.com/forums/commentrss.aspx?SectionID=289&amp;PostID=3546678</wfw:commentRss><description>I do not think kids should wear seat belts on a bus. I drove bus for 12 years, both the "short bus" and the big buses. The special needs bus had several seat belts and wheel chairs. I had no aide to help on the bus due to funding. The children's risk to have a seat belt verses going with out one was greater. I make this point because wearing a seat belt on a bus is dangerous. The seats are high backed and straight. If a bus were in a collision, the child would suffer broken necks and head damage because they would be slammed into the seats they are sitting in or the windows. Without belts, they move with the impact but a shorter distance, while they would have injuries, they would not necessarily result in brain damage or death, which has been proven in crash testing. Bus seats are designed to cause the least amount of injury and hold up to the childrens "use" and abuse.
